Understanding Odoo: An Overview
What is Odoo?
Odoo is a powerful, open-source ERP platform that offers a suite of business applications to help manage various aspects of your business, such as sales, inventory, accounting, HR, and more. What sets Odoo apart is its flexibility and scalability, making it suitable for companies of all sizes. However, the most attractive feature for non-technical users is its user-friendly interface and the ability to perform many tasks without writing a single line of code.

Using Odoo Studio
Odoo Studio is a powerful tool that allows you to create and modify applications within Odoo without knowing how to code. Whether you want to create a new form, customize an existing one, or design a new report, Odoo Studio makes it easy for non-technical users to make the most of Odoo.
Automating Processes
Automation is another area where Odoo excels; the best part is that you don’t need to write any code to take advantage of it. You can set up automated workflows for tasks such as sending invoices, following up on leads, and updating inventory levels. This is an excellent way for non-technical users to improve efficiency without getting bogged down in technical details.

Managing Customer Relationships
Odoo’s CRM module is one of the most powerful tools available to non-technical users. It allows you to manage customer relationships, track leads, and automate follow-ups without writing a single line of code.
Simplifying Inventory Management
Odoo’s Inventory module is designed to simplify stock management for non-technical users. With features like barcode scanning and automated stock updates, inventory management has always been challenging. The module also integrates flawlessly with other parts of the platform, such as sales and accounting, allowing you to manage your entire supply chain without coding.
Reshuffling Accounting Processes
Odoo’s accounting module offers a range of features designed to rationalize financial management for non-technical users. You can automate invoicing, expense tracking, and financial reporting tasks with just a few clicks. The module also provides real-time insights into your financial performance, helping you make informed decisions without needing any technical expertise.
